New Jersey Statutes, Title: App.A, EMERGENCY AND TEMPORARY ACTS

    Chapter 9: Removal of member of local defense council

      Section: App.A:9-57.7: Persons entitled to benefits

           Benefits as provided in this act shall be the exclusive remedy of a civil defense volunteer, his or her spouse, dependents, or legal representative or representatives, for any injury, disease or death arising out of and in the course of civil defense volunteer service, as against the State, any political subdivision of this State, any civil defense agency or any person or other agency acting under governmental authority in furtherance of civil defense activities, with or without negligence. A member of a civil defense agency of the Federal Government or of another State, who may perform services within this State, whether pursuant to a mutual aid compact or otherwise, shall not be entitled to benefits under the provisions of this act.

L.1952, c. 12, p. 56, s. 7.
